Grey’s monument was named after the second Early Grey (yes, the tea, but he was also a Prime Minister).  The monument is occasionally open to the public to climb up the 164 steps on the inside and I was lucky enough to buy a ticket.  The first two pics are the monument, the rest are from the platform near the top that you can see.
